I am changing my 14" minilites with 185-60-14 pilots to 13" superlites.What would be the best size / combination,i.e 185-60-13 front and 205-60-13 rear?? Going onto a 1999 1.6 Roadsport. Any advice?? Not sure you need 205s on the rear unless you are planning major power upgrades. You'll probably find it'll understeer quite badly unless you make other setup changes.

Would'nt 185-60-13 upset the gearing??? Also ,would ride height be a problem??? I have standard Blisteins so unable to raise the ride height.
So if you can't raise the ride height to compensate buy 185-70-13 tyres as they will give the same ride height/speedo read-out as 185-60-14.
